Introduction
The bucket cylinder is a specially designed hydraulic cylinder used to control the movement of the bucket in heavy machinery such as excavators, backhoe loaders, and front loaders. Its main function is to enable the lifting, lowering, and tilting of the bucket, making it easier to handle various material handling tasks. In a hydraulic system, the bucket cylinder achieves precise control of the bucket by varying the pressure of hydraulic oil, allowing the operator to efficiently handle heavy loads and adapt to complex working environments and diverse operational requirements.
Features
- High Strength and Durability: Typically made from high-strength steel or aluminum, the bucket cylinder can withstand high pressure and heavy loads, adapting to harsh working conditions. Its design takes into consideration wear resistance and corrosion resistance, extending its lifespan.
- Efficient Hydraulic Operation: Utilizing the pressure of hydraulic oil, the bucket cylinder achieves smooth extension and retraction actions, allowing for quick response to control commands and providing powerful pushing and pulling forces. It is suitable for handling heavy loads and complex operational tasks.
- Various Types: The bucket cylinder can be chosen as single-acting (hydraulic used in one direction only) or double-acting (hydraulic used in both directions) cylinders, depending on the operational requirements. Some models are telescopic, allowing for greater extension without increasing external dimensions, making them suitable for applications with limited space.

Applications
The bucket cylinder finds applications in various equipment:
- Construction Equipment: Found in excavators, they are essential for digging, loading, and moving soil or debris. In backhoe loaders, the bucket cylinder assists in both digging and lifting.
- Agricultural Machinery: Used in front loaders for scooping, lifting, and transporting soil, hay, and other materials.
- Excavators: The bucket cylinder enables digging actions by allowing the bucket to penetrate the soil.
- Front Loaders: In front loaders, they facilitate efficient lifting and dumping of goods.

Sealing and Lubrication
The bucket cylinder utilizes various sealing components, such as piston seals and rod seals, made of wear-resistant materials like polyurethane and nitrile rubber. The cylinder body and threaded ends undergo precise treatment to enhance wear resistance. Regular lubrication with the appropriate amount of hydraulic oil is necessary to ensure smooth operation.
Regular Inspection and Preventive Maintenance
To ensure the optimal performance of the bucket cylinder, regular inspections and preventive maintenance measures are recommended:
- Regular inspection of the cylinder for any signs of wear or damage.
- Appropriate lubrication of moving parts to reduce friction and ensure smooth operation.
- Periodic replacement of seals and calibration checks to maintain proper functioning.

Failure Diagnosis and Common Issues
Common issues and troubleshooting tips for the bucket cylinder:
- Leakage: Check the seals and replace if necessary. Ensure proper lubrication.
- Slow Operation: Inspect the hydraulic system for any blockages or insufficient pressure.
- Abnormal Noise: Check for loose components and worn-out parts. Lubricate as needed.
- Uneven Movement: Inspect the cylinder for any misalignment or damaged components. Adjust or replace as necessary.
